In your opinion, how should a man dress, behave and talk? There is no single Standard(标准). Many girls today love  xiaoxianrou, or "little fresh meat", which refers to young male stars who are delicate(精致的) and cute. Of course, there are also people who still appreciate the traditional male image of being muscular(肌肉发达的) and strong.

This topic caused some heated discussions across China in September.

It started when CCTV invited four young actors to perform on First Class for the New Semester(《开学第一课》), an educational TV show for primary and secondary school students that aired on Sept.1. The four actors all appeared feminine(女性化的), having slender frames(苗条身材)and wearing makeup.

Afterwards, criticism(批评) of their appearance(外表) was everywhere on the Internet. Some called the actors "sissies", a word that is used to refer to men who have a "soft" appearance. Some parents believe that popularizing this kind of soft male image is in poor taste and could have an influence on their children's personal development.

"As famous stars, the male idols(偶像) focused too much on their appearance and failed to act as proper role models, "Xinhua said. "If men behave this way, China will never become the strong country it hopes to be", Xinhua added.

However, others have a more open mind toward it. "It's a stereotype(刻板印象)to think all male stars should be as masculine as Jackie Chan. As society diversifies( 多样化), there are more options(选项) for fans to choose from, "Liang Yurou,19, a college student from Fujian Province, told China Daily.

Some people also pointed out that gender can be expressed in different ways. As a male, caring about one's appearance has nothing to do with one's degree of "manliness".

"No matter what kind of personal style or quality he or she chooses to present, whether it is strong-willed or gentle, that doesn't stop them from being an excellent person, "China Women's Daily said in a report.

This was echoed( 附和)by People's Daily. "A man's strength should be judged (评判)according to their inner qualities-not their physical appearance, "it said in an article.
